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: VDR Portal.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

Samstag, 31. Dezember 2005, 03:31

image Plugin und RAW-Kameradateien?

Hallo,

hat sich irgend jemand schon mal daran versucht RAW-Dateien (wie etwa Nikons nef) mit dem image Plugin angezeigt zu bekommen? *.nef in die imagesources.conf mit aufzunehmen ist zwar eine Möglichkeit, dadurch werden zumindest die in den RAW-Bilddateien engebetteten JPG bzw. TIF-Vorschaubilder angezeigt, aber die Auflösung ist aber entsprechend besch...eiden.

Danke :)
yaVDR 0.5 Server: Satix S2 Dual, Technisat DVB-T
yaVDR 0.5 Client: POV ION-MB330
yaVDR 0.3 Client: S100 mit Scart-Out
Raspberry 2 Clients

2

Samstag, 31. Dezember 2005, 08:18

RE: image Plugin und RAW-Kameradateien?

Moin,

folgendes Patch von anytopnm könnte helfen, der Script sollte unter /usr/bin zu finden sein, und gehört zum netpbm-Paket.

Quellcode

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
--- anytopnm.org	2005-12-31 07:57:24.000000000 +0100
+++ anytopnm	2005-12-31 08:04:40.000000000 +0100
@@ -99,9 +99,9 @@
     giftopnm "$file"
     ;;
 
-    *TIFF* )
-    tifftopnm "$file"
-    ;;
+#    *TIFF* )
+#    tifftopnm "$file"
+#    ;;
 
     *IFF*ILBM* )
     ilbmtoppm "$file"
@@ -241,6 +241,9 @@
         *.mda | *.mdp )
         mdatopbm -d -- "$file"
         ;;
+        *.nef | *.crw | *.cr2 )
+        dcraw -2 -c -w "$file"
+        ;;
         * )
         echo "$0: unknown file type: $filetype" 1>&2
         exit 1


Benötigt wird dann dcraw von http://www.cybercom.net/~dcoffin/dcraw/

Interessant wäre noch was "file" über den nef-Dateityp sagt, habe leider nur cr2 Dateien hier.

PHP-Quelltext

1
2
file img_1220.cr2 cut -d: -f2-
 TIFF image datalittle-endian


Deswegen ist im obrigen Patch auch das Filetypen abhängige "case "$filetype" in *TIFF* " auskommentiert.


Cu,
Andreas
System: VDR 2.2 unter Debian Wheezy
Aktive Projekte : Radiorecorder Web GUI | targa VFD Plugin | XXV - Xtreme eXtension for VDR

3

Sonntag, 1. Januar 2006, 01:32

Danke Andreas.

Dave Coffins dcraw hab ich mir eh schon besorgt gehabt.
NEF-Dateien sind auch vom Dateityp TIFF und habe die entsprechenden Zeilen auskommentiert. Leider klappt aber das Anzeigen von nef-Dateien bzw. die Konvertierung mittels dcraw nach Ergänzung der drei neuen Zeilen in anytopnm nicht, ich erhalte die Meldung: "Konnte Bild nicht lesen : No such file or directory".

[edit]
Am Terminal ausgeführt erzeugt dcraw (ohne -c) eine ppm-Datei, die auch angezeigt werden kann.
[/edit]

[edit]
hier die log-Einträge vom image Plugin:

Quellcode

1
2
3
imageplugin.sh: called 'imageplugin.sh /var/lib/video/Bilder/_DSC0893.NEF /tmp/image/VY6TUJX.pnm 688 544 0 0 0'
imageplugin.sh: /usr/bin/anytopnm: unknown file type:  TIFF image data, big-endian
imageplugin.sh: Error! Stopped without found created /tmp/image/VY6TUJX.pnm, converting should failed !
Es ist also doch ein Unterschied welches TIFF, hier big-endian. Der Eintrag muss wohl anders aussehen 8o
[/edit]

[last edit?]
Ach, arbeitet ja case sensitive - und da NEF in Großbuchstaben als Endung... Jetzt klappt's mit entsprechendem zusätzlichen Eintrag. Die Fehlermeldung am Bildschirm ist aber auch verwirrend...]
[/edit]

Ansonsten: Frohes Neues :rolleyes:

Werner
yaVDR 0.5 Server: Satix S2 Dual, Technisat DVB-T
yaVDR 0.5 Client: POV ION-MB330
yaVDR 0.3 Client: S100 mit Scart-Out
Raspberry 2 Clients

Dieser Beitrag wurde bereits 4 mal editiert, zuletzt von »scovery« (1. Januar 2006, 02:13)


4

Sonntag, 15. Januar 2006, 09:08

Mh, sehe ich das richtig, das ich hier mit mir meine RAW Bilder (Canon 1D Mark II) über das VDR angucken kann?
Hardware:
Aopen i915Ga-HFS / Pentium-M 750 / LC13 / Samsung SP2504C S-ATA / 2 GB Ram / DVB-S FF 2.1 + 4 MB Mod + CI Erweiterung / DVB-T FF 1.2 / LG GSA-4167B

5

Sonntag, 15. Januar 2006, 10:33

Zitat

Original von pcollins
Mh, sehe ich das richtig, das ich hier mit mir meine RAW Bilder (Canon 1D Mark II) über das VDR angucken kann?


Wenn das Format der Cam durch dcraw unterstützt wird, von einer EOS weis ich es.
Wenn dcraw bei dir installiert ist und Du des Patchen von anytopnm mächig bist, sollte kein Problem sein.:mua


anytopnm gehört zum paket netpbm, und wird von Plugin durch den Script "imageplugin.sh" aufgerufen.
»Hulk« hat folgende Datei angehängt:
System: VDR 2.2 unter Debian Wheezy
Aktive Projekte : Radiorecorder Web GUI | targa VFD Plugin | XXV - Xtreme eXtension for VDR

6

Sonntag, 15. Januar 2006, 12:57

Canon 1D wird soweit ich weiß auch von Dcraw unterstützt - klappt ja sogar schon mit Nikons D200 NEF! Soweit ich es verstanden habe soll Dcraw prinzipiell alle RAWs ohne zusätzliche Änderung öffnen können.

Geschwindigkeit darf man allerdings keine allzu hohe erwarten. Mit meinen 600 MHz dauert's pro GB RAW Datei so etwa 8 Sekunden für die Konvertierung.
yaVDR 0.5 Server: Satix S2 Dual, Technisat DVB-T
yaVDR 0.5 Client: POV ION-MB330
yaVDR 0.3 Client: S100 mit Scart-Out
Raspberry 2 Clients

7

Sonntag, 15. Januar 2006, 15:28

Hallo,

das klingt doch alles sehr gut, und das werde ich mir wohl dann nächstes Wochenende alles angucken.

Zitat

Original von scovery
Geschwindigkeit darf man allerdings keine allzu hohe erwarten. Mit meinen 600 MHz dauert's pro GB RAW Datei so etwa 8 Sekunden für die Konvertierung.


Mh, verstehe ich dich richtig? Das umwandeln für 1 GB an RAW-Daten dauert ca.8 Sekunden auf deinem 600 MHz Rechner? Wenn ja, ist das doch sehr fix, oder? Also ich hab hier auf meinem P4 2.8 GHZ brauche ich mit ACDSee 8.x länger...

mfg
Hardware:
Aopen i915Ga-HFS / Pentium-M 750 / LC13 / Samsung SP2504C S-ATA / 2 GB Ram / DVB-S FF 2.1 + 4 MB Mod + CI Erweiterung / DVB-T FF 1.2 / LG GSA-4167B

8

Montag, 16. Januar 2006, 03:01

Zitat

Original von pcollinsMh, verstehe ich dich richtig? Das umwandeln für 1 GB an RAW-Daten dauert ca.8 Sekunden auf deinem 600 MHz Rechner? Wenn ja, ist das doch sehr fix, oder? Also ich hab hier auf meinem P4 2.8 GHZ brauche ich mit ACDSee 8.x länger...

Ähm - war wohl zu der Zeit noch nicht richtig munter :D
Sollte 1MB heißen - nicht 1GB 8)
yaVDR 0.5 Server: Satix S2 Dual, Technisat DVB-T
yaVDR 0.5 Client: POV ION-MB330
yaVDR 0.3 Client: S100 mit Scart-Out
Raspberry 2 Clients

Immortal Romance Spielautomat